In plain English
Causal discovery algorithms often struggle with identifying true causal relationships due to the assumption of faithfulness, which can be violated in natural systems. This paper highlights that hard interventions can provide crucial information that is typically overlooked in traditional methods. By proposing a new assumption called intervention-immediacy faithfulness, the authors enable the identification of causal structures despite the presence of cancellations.
